Grow with AppMaster Grow with AppMaster.
Become our partner arrow ico

कुप्पी

वेबसाइट विकास के संदर्भ में, फ्लास्क एक हल्के वेब एप्लिकेशन ढांचे को संदर्भित करता है जिसका उपयोग वेब-आधारित अनुप्रयोगों और एपीआई को कुशलतापूर्वक और न्यूनतम सेटअप के साथ बनाने के लिए व्यापक रूप से किया जाता है। पायथन में तैयार, फ्लास्क एक लचीली वास्तुकला का उपयोग करता है जो गति, स्केलेबिलिटी और उपयोग में आसानी के मामले में कई फायदे प्रदान करता है, जिससे यह AppMaster no-code प्लेटफॉर्म पर काम करने वाले वेबसाइट डेवलपर्स सहित एक लोकप्रिय विकल्प बन जाता है।

इसके मूल में, फ्लास्क Werkzeug WSGI (वेब ​​सर्वर गेटवे इंटरफ़ेस) टूलकिट और Jinja2 टेम्प्लेटिंग इंजन पर आधारित है, जिनमें से दोनों की स्थिरता और विश्वसनीयता के लिए एक ठोस प्रतिष्ठा है। जबकि फ्लास्क डिफ़ॉल्ट रूप से एक माइक्रो-फ्रेमवर्क है, इसकी कार्यक्षमता को बढ़ाने के लिए इसे कई प्लगइन्स के साथ बढ़ाया जा सकता है, जिससे यह सादगी और बहुमुखी प्रतिभा के बीच संतुलन चाहने वाले डेवलपर्स के लिए एक आकर्षक विकल्प बन जाता है। कुछ उल्लेखनीय फ्लास्क प्लगइन्स में डेटाबेस एकीकरण के लिए फ्लास्क-एसक्यूएलकेमी, रेस्टफुल एपीआई विकसित करने के लिए फ्लास्क-रेस्टफुल और उपयोगकर्ता प्रमाणीकरण के प्रबंधन के लिए फ्लास्क-लॉगिन शामिल हैं।

फ्लास्क की एक पहचान वेब विकास के लिए इसका न्यूनतम और मॉड्यूलर दृष्टिकोण है, जिसके परिणामस्वरूप अन्य रूपरेखाओं की तुलना में सीखने की अवस्था कम होती है। यह इसे उन प्रोग्रामर्स के लिए आदर्श बनाता है जो जटिल फुल-स्टैक वेब फ्रेमवर्क के माध्यम से काम किए बिना जल्दी से प्रूफ-ऑफ-कॉन्सेप्ट प्रोजेक्ट, प्रोटोटाइप या सिंगल-पेज एप्लिकेशन बनाना चाहते हैं। फ्लास्क की सादगी बड़े ढांचे से जुड़े अधिकांश ओवरहेड को भी नकार देती है, जिससे तेजी से विकास और तैनाती का समय हो सकता है।

AppMaster, बैकएंड, वेब और मोबाइल एप्लिकेशन विकास में विशेषज्ञता वाले एक no-code प्लेटफ़ॉर्म के रूप में, व्यापक वेब विकास पारिस्थितिकी तंत्र में फ्लास्क के मूल्य को भी पहचानता है। फ्लास्क को बैकएंड वेब फ्रेमवर्क के रूप में नियोजित करके, AppMaster कुशल, उच्च-प्रदर्शन स्रोत कोड की पीढ़ी सुनिश्चित करता है जो जेनरेट किए गए बैकएंड अनुप्रयोगों के निर्बाध निष्पादन को शक्ति प्रदान करता है। यह AppMaster तेजी से विकास के समय और लागत प्रभावी समाधानों को बनाए रखते हुए, छोटे व्यवसायों से लेकर उद्यमों तक, उपयोग के मामलों की एक विस्तृत श्रृंखला को पूरा करने की अनुमति देता है।

फ्लास्क की अनुकूलन क्षमता कई डेटाबेस के साथ सहजता से एकीकृत होने की क्षमता में प्रदर्शित होती है, जो किसी भी आधुनिक वेब एप्लिकेशन का एक महत्वपूर्ण पहलू है। इन डेटाबेसों में PostgreSQL है, जिसे AppMaster एप्लिकेशन वर्तमान में अपने प्राथमिक डेटाबेस के रूप में समर्थन करते हैं। यह अनुकूलता एक मजबूत बैकएंड फ्रेमवर्क के रूप में AppMaster के जेनरेट किए गए स्रोत कोड और फ्लास्क की विशेषता के बीच सहक्रियात्मक संबंध को दर्शाती है।

एंटरप्राइज़-स्तरीय एप्लिकेशन सुरक्षा और स्थिरता की मांग करते हैं, और फ्लास्क इन मोर्चों पर भी काम करता है। अपनी मजबूत सुरक्षा स्थिति के साथ, फ्लास्क विभिन्न वेब एप्लिकेशन कमजोरियों जैसे क्रॉस-साइट स्क्रिप्टिंग (एक्सएसएस), क्रॉस-साइट रिक्वेस्ट फोर्जरी (सीएसआरएफ), और एसक्यूएल इंजेक्शन के खिलाफ अंतर्निहित सुरक्षा प्रदान करता है, यह सुनिश्चित करता है कि जेनरेट किए गए एप्लिकेशन के पास तैनाती के लिए एक सुरक्षित आधार है। . इसके अलावा, त्वरित, ऑन-द-फ्लाई एप्लिकेशन अपडेट के लिए फ्लास्क का समर्थन समग्र रखरखाव को बढ़ाता है और तकनीकी ऋण को न्यूनतम कर देता है।

फ्लास्क के लिए प्राथमिक उपयोग मामलों में से एक एपीआई का निर्माण करना है, जो एप्लिकेशन प्रोग्रामिंग इंटरफेस के लिए है। एपीआई में रूटीन, प्रोटोकॉल और टूल शामिल होते हैं जो विभिन्न सॉफ़्टवेयर एप्लिकेशन को एक दूसरे के साथ संचार करने में सक्षम बनाते हैं। REST, या रिप्रेजेंटेशनल स्टेट ट्रांसफर, एक वास्तुशिल्प डिजाइन है जो एपीआई के बीच मानकीकरण बनाए रखने के लिए विशिष्ट दिशानिर्देशों का सख्ती से पालन करता है। फ्लास्क डेवलपर्स को RESTful API बनाने के लिए एक कुशल साधन प्रदान करता है, जो प्लेटफ़ॉर्म-स्वतंत्र, स्टेटलेस, कैशेबल और स्व-वर्णनात्मक हैं। परिणामस्वरूप, फ्लास्क का उपयोग करके एपीआई बनाने से प्रदर्शन, स्केलेबिलिटी और विश्वसनीयता में सुधार होता है।

AppMaster इकोसिस्टम में फ्लास्क का उपयोग फ्रेमवर्क की विश्वसनीयता, सरलता और दक्षता की स्वीकृति है। बैकएंड एप्लिकेशन बनाने में फ्लास्क को एक महत्वपूर्ण घटक के रूप में नियोजित करके, AppMaster वेब डेवलपर्स को अपने वेब एप्लिकेशन को पहले से कहीं अधिक तेजी से, सुरक्षित और लागत प्रभावी ढंग से बनाने, प्रकाशित करने और प्रबंधित करने में सक्षम बनाता है।

अंत में, फ्लास्क एक हल्का, लचीला और शक्तिशाली वेब फ्रेमवर्क है जो डेवलपर्स को सुव्यवस्थित और कुशल तरीके से वेब एप्लिकेशन और एपीआई बनाने की अनुमति देता है। अन्य प्लेटफार्मों, जैसे कि AppMaster की no-code कार्यक्षमताओं के साथ इसकी अनुकूलता, अत्यधिक स्केलेबल और रखरखाव योग्य अनुप्रयोगों के तेजी से और सुरक्षित विकास की अनुमति देती है। सादगी, अनुकूलनशीलता और गति पर ध्यान केंद्रित करने के साथ, फ्लास्क ने खुद को वेब डेवलपर्स के लिए एक विश्वसनीय और महत्वपूर्ण उपकरण के रूप में साबित किया है, जिसमें AppMaster पारिस्थितिकी तंत्र के भीतर काम करने वाले लोग भी शामिल हैं।

संबंधित पोस्ट

मोबाइल ऐप मुद्रीकरण रणनीतियों को अनलॉक करने की कुंजी
मोबाइल ऐप मुद्रीकरण रणनीतियों को अनलॉक करने की कुंजी
विज्ञापन, इन-ऐप खरीदारी और सदस्यता सहित सिद्ध मुद्रीकरण रणनीतियों के साथ अपने मोबाइल ऐप की पूर्ण राजस्व क्षमता को अनलॉक करने का तरीका जानें।
एआई ऐप क्रिएटर चुनते समय मुख्य बातें
एआई ऐप क्रिएटर चुनते समय मुख्य बातें
एआई ऐप क्रिएटर चुनते समय, एकीकरण क्षमताओं, उपयोग में आसानी और स्केलेबिलिटी जैसे कारकों पर विचार करना आवश्यक है। यह लेख आपको एक सूचित विकल्प चुनने के लिए मुख्य विचारों के माध्यम से मार्गदर्शन करता है।
PWA में प्रभावी पुश सूचनाओं के लिए युक्तियाँ
PWA में प्रभावी पुश सूचनाओं के लिए युक्तियाँ
प्रोग्रेसिव वेब ऐप्स (पीडब्ल्यूए) के लिए प्रभावी पुश नोटिफिकेशन तैयार करने की कला की खोज करें जो उपयोगकर्ता जुड़ाव को बढ़ावा देती है और यह सुनिश्चित करती है कि आपके संदेश भीड़ भरे डिजिटल स्थान पर खड़े हों।
निःशुल्क आरंभ करें
इसे स्वयं आजमाने के लिए प्रेरित हुए?

AppMaster की शक्ति को समझने का सबसे अच्छा तरीका है इसे अपने लिए देखना। निःशुल्क सब्सक्रिप्शन के साथ मिनटों में अपना स्वयं का एप्लिकेशन बनाएं

अपने विचारों को जीवन में उतारें